Leopold, Duke of Brabant, later Leopold II (1835-1909)

c.1860

Albumen print | 8.8 x 5.6 cm (image) | RCIN 2907578

Photograph of a full length portrait of Leopold, Duke of Brabant, later Leopold II (1835-1909), standing facing front. He wears a military uniform with epaulettes. He rests his right hand on a book on the table beside him.
